Leveling question

Me and my wife are new to the game. I have played other MMOs before so I looked at some builds online. However until I get to the higher level skills of the build I have to increase other skills. Am I going to have enough points for all my skills when I am max level? Or am I gonna have to reset my stats? If this is the case, is it expensive to reset?

Yes, you will have enough to get all of them to at least rank 3, and later to 4 (it is possible to max them all).
One thing though, in 12 days or so, console will receive the Mod 16 update, which changes many aspects of the game including those powers points part. They will be removed, and you will just unlock powers as you level until you reach the maximum level, which will be increased from level 70 to 80.

In general, reseting is not expensive, you get a couple for free, and you get quite a lot free tokens on some events like winter event. Overall, even without the events and free tokens, reseting is not an issue (especially in more end-game terms and overall economy and prices).

There are also loadouts, you will get 2 for free, and can buy up to a total of 10 slots. Eeach loadout can be specced separately, so you can consider this also as a free reset (the second one that is unlocked comes clear, so you are free to set it as you like).

Yea don't worry about it for right now. Just bobble around and enjoy the freedom of newness. Don't bother investing much time in learning the character mechanics and all that. Mod 16 nukes all of that. It tears stuff out and doesn't replace it with much.

Power points, feats, many powers, etc are poof gone in a little under 2 weeks.
